THE NEW ERA, Baltimore, Maryland, April 27, 1864 

* Rare Civil War title

A very uncommon title which lasted for only 15 issues, this being issue #9. Over half of the issue is taken up with ads, with some news items: "A Soldier's Penmanship" "Then and Now" and much more. Page 4 has an item: "Jeff. Davis has won a new title to infamous immortality, by his butcheries of white and black Union soldiers at Fort Pillow and Plymouth, after surrender. He is now Jeff. Davis, the parricide and butcher!..." and more (see photos).
The back page has a large illustration of the: "Ground Plan Of Fair Tables".
Four pages, never bound nor trimmed, 11 1/2 by 16 1/2 inches, minor spine wear, nice condition.
